To compare the best concession trailers in Lawton, Oklahoma, use the same evidence standard for every unit. For Lawton, compare what is documented now with the work still required before the trailer can operate. For custom work, require a dimensioned drawing and named equipment schedule showing counters, clearances, sinks, tanks, utilities, ventilation, windows, doors, storage, and revision history. For a used unit, reconcile title or VIN records with structure, leaks, running gear, tires, brakes, appliances, modifications, connected systems, and likely repair work. The written result should identify the exact trailer, remaining work, and who must verify each item.

| Compare | Evidence for Lawton buyers | Decision to resolve |
|---|---|---|
| Identity and sale status | Stock number, title or VIN, current photos, location, price, availability and terms | Is the written offer for the exact trailer reviewed? |
| Kitchen and workflow | Scaled floorplan, equipment models, sinks, storage, windows, aisle and clearances | Can the crew complete the busiest service period safely? |
| Connected systems | Electrical schedule, propane, water, waste, ventilation, suppression and manuals | Do qualified calculations support every installed item? |
| Weight and movement | Available weight information, axles, tires, brakes, coupler, tow vehicle and route | Can the complete loaded combination travel and arrive as planned? |
| Local review | Current written health, fire, zoning, licensing, event and property instructions | What must be reviewed before equipment placement is final? |
